Attempt to rob Dh500,000 foiled in Dubai, gang of four members arrested
Defendants attacked bitcoin buyer and his friends and sprayed deodorants on their faces
Robbers in Dubai tried to snatch Dh500,000 in cash from an investor who wanted to buy bitcoins. Picture for illustrative purposes only.
Image Credit: Gulf News Archives
Dubai: A group of four Dubai-based expatriates has been accused of attempted robbery of Dh500,000 from an investor in a fraudulent bitcoin transaction.
According to the Dubai Court of First Instance, the four Ukrainian defendants aged between 28 and 34 years, broke into an office in the Al Barsha area of Dubai and tried to steal the cryptocurrency after attacking the investor and two of his friends.
A 33-year-old Egyptian witness, who was told by the investor and another person to join them in buying the cryptocurrency, said that he went to the office carrying Dh500,000 in cash in a bag. “A man told us to wait until the arrival of the bitcoin seller. As they were getting late, the victim told the man that they would leave, when the door opened and the four Ukrainian suspects came in, attacked the victim and tried to steal the money,” said the Egyptian witness.
The four defendants physically assaulted the victims and sprayed a deodorant directly on to the victims faces.
“As the victim raised an alarm, screaming thieves ... thieves the attackers couldnt steal the money and they escaped from the spot,” added the Egyptian witness.
Dubai Police have arrested all the four defendants who were charged with attempted robbery.

European gang attempts to rob Dhs500,000 from three Arabs
The Dubai Public Prosecution arrested and referred a four-member European gang of to the criminal court for attempting to rob three Arabs of Dhs500,000 during a bitcoin exchange deal in Dubai.
The incident dates back to August 2019.
One of the victims filed a report against the four defendants, claiming that they attempted to rob his money during his visit to an office, which was trading in bitcoin.
The victim testified that he was in the company of two of his friends, with a bag of Dhs500,000, to buy bitcoin with a value less than the market.
The victims were asked to wait for the office to open. The Arabs were suddenly interrupted by the Europeans.
The four of them assaulted the victims and tried to take away the bag of money, but luckily, the victims were screaming loudly and one of them had used his body deodorant to spray on the robbers faces.
The defendants got scared and left the scene before being able to rob the Arabs of Dhs500,000. Police identified the defendants and successfully apprehended each one of them.
The defendants confessed to being engaged in a fight with the victims, but with no intention of stealing their money.
